
There are a pair of meetings on tap for today (February 12th) in the City of Manitowoc.
The Board of Public Works will be in the Council Chambers at 4:00 p.m., where they will review a pair of appeals submitted by residents.
The first is for a snow removal assessment in the 1800 block of South 39th Street.
The second is for a noxious weed assessment in the 3300 block of Mero Street.
The group will also look over bids for an upcoming sewer relining project and quotes for a new compressed air system.
At the same time, the Industrial Development Corporation will be in the second-floor conference room to discuss a parcel of land off of West Drive.
